题42
题目
在请求分页存储管理系统中,为了提高 TLB 命中率,可行的方法是 ( )。
I. 增大 TLB 容量
II. 采用多级页表
III. 提高页面大小
IV. 降低页面大小
A. I 和 III
B. I 和 IV
C. I、II 和 III
D. II 和 III
分析
增大 TLB 容量可以提高 TLB 命中率, 因为可以缓冲更多的地址映射。
采用多级页表对 TLB 命中率没有影响。
提高页面大小可用较少的页面覆盖更大的地址空间, 从而减少页表项, 因此可以提高 TLB 命中率。
反之, 降低页面大小则会降低 TLB 命中率。
解
A